Folios 396-397: George Irwin, Regulating Officer, Deal. Reports that Lieutenant Charles Pye Turner arrived at Deal yesterday evening and he is very sorry to say got so beastly Drunk in a Common Public House as to expose his orders and Press Warrant to all the Boatmen & Common People in the Tap Room. On being seen by him this morning they were dirty and filthy to a degree. Rear Admiral Keeler and several Gentlemen inhabitants here who have known him from his infancy say he is the Drunkenest wretch that can live and will get into a scrape as soon as he joins the Duty. He will defer sending him to Dover until he knows their Lordships pleasure. He states that Dover is the best place for raising men in all this District, if a safe Active Officer had the appointment. The current Officers is a hard drinker and not equal to the Service.
